The State Council of Vocational Training (SCVT), Lucknow, has officially commenced the registration process for ITI admissions across Uttar Pradesh for the 2026 academic session. This admission cycle provides a pathway for students to enroll in various technical and vocational trades offered by government-affiliated industrial training institutes. The program is designed to equip candidates with practical skills necessary for industrial employment and self-reliance.

How to Apply

  1. Visit the official SCVT Uttar Pradesh website at scvtup.in.
  2. Locate and click on the link for UP ITI Admission 2026.
  3. Register by providing essential details including name, father's name, date of birth, and mobile number.
  4. Verify your mobile number using the OTP sent to your device.
  5. Complete the application form by entering educational and communication details.
  6. Upload the necessary documents as specified in the portal instructions.
  7. Pay the required application fee through the available online payment methods.
  8. Submit the final application and download the confirmation page for your records.

Application Fee

General and OBC candidates: Rs. 250. SC and ST candidates: Rs. 150. Fees must be paid online.

Age Limit

Minimum 14 years; no upper age limit.

Selection Process

Admission to the ITI programs is conducted entirely on a merit basis. There is no entrance examination for this cycle. The selection authority prepares a merit list based on the marks obtained by candidates in their Class 10 or equivalent qualifying examination. Following the merit list publication, candidates are invited for a counseling session. This stage involves the selection of preferred trades and institutes, followed by seat allotment and mandatory document verification to finalize the admission.

The State Council of Vocational Training (SCVT), Lucknow, operates under the Government of Uttar Pradesh. It is responsible for overseeing vocational education and training across the state. The council manages the curriculum, examination standards, and admission processes for various Industrial Training Institutes (ITIs). Its primary mandate is to provide high-quality technical training to the youth, fostering skill development and enhancing employment opportunities in various industrial sectors throughout the region.
